View NotesGeneral Notes: An excellent Miller SBD made this matrix very enjoyable to do. The Wagner AUD is nice, and although distant at first, it does improve and adds extra energy into an already raging performance. Half-Step, Bertha> Good Lovin', and the only Dew of '78 are highlights. Thanks to Charlie Miller for the kind SBD, and to Bob wagner for recording the AUD and David Minches for the transfer. Artwork by Paul Gilbert - thanks! Enjoy! -Chappy _________________________________ Editing Notes: - Pitch/Synch The SBD needed to be pitched up between 2 and 7 cents starting at Friend 'O through Sunrise. For the rest of the show the SBD had to be pitched up 10 cents. The AUD on average had to be pitched down between -2 and -5 cents until Playin', and for the remainder of the show, the AUD was pitched up on average 3 cents. The AUD was synched to the SBD. - Sonic Quality/Matrix ratio No EQ was applied to either source. Waves L2 was used to avoid square waves, the levels rarely hitting zero. If I had to guess, the SBD/AUD ratio would be somewhere around 3:1. - Edits The following are places where the SBD and AUD had splices, holes or incomplete coverage in reference to the final matrix timeline. SBD: s1t01 (0:00 - 0:52) - missing (crowd) s1t01 (9:59 - 10:33) - missing (crowd) s1t04 (7:07 - 7:25) - missing (crowd) s1t05 (4:30 - 4:41) - missing (crowd) s1t06 (5:17 - 6:00) - missing (crowd) s1t08 (7:00 - 7:18) - missing (crowd) s2t01 (0:00 - 0:39) - missing (crowd) s2t03 (6:47 - 7:31) - missing (crowd) s2t04 (7:28 - 7:46) - missing (crowd) s2t08 (6:42 - 7:01) - missing s2t10 (8:21 - 9:48) - missing (crowd) AUD: s1t01 (10:38 - 11:13) - missing (crowd) s1t03 (4:28 - 4:53) - missing (crowd) s1t07 (14:27 - 14:44) - missing (crowd) s2t03>4 (7:53 - 0:03) - missing first few notes s2t04 (8:31 - 9:50) - missing (crowd) s2t07 (2:07 + 2:10) - eliminated dropouts s2t08 (0:26 - 0:35) - missing Note that alot of the missing elements are just crowd segments, except for the AUD missing the first few notes of Candyman, and both sources missing sections of NFA, thankfully not in the same place, thus full coverage is achieved. _________________________________
